About this experience

While exploring about traditional ways of life, you will get to know the distinct flavors of the local Indian cuisine. You can choose unusual ingredients, go to the neighborhood vegetable market, and learn how to prepare five common recipes as part of this session.

Sarahfg123 · March 2026

Enjoyable cookery lesson in Jaipur

My evening spent learning to cook in a private Jaipur home was a highlight of my trip, offering a warm and authentic glimpse into Rajasthani hospitality. I was welcomed into a vibrant family kitchen, and learnt how to make a delicious palak paneer, dal and chapatis. My hosts were informative, friendly and patient, and it made for a very enjoyable and tasty evening.
